Rockwood is a historic house in the vicinity of Montpelier Station, Orange County, Virginia.
It was built in 1848 and is a 2+1⁄2-story frame house which was designed in a blend of the Gothic Revival and Greek Revival styles.
The house sits on a brick English basement and has an offset sharply pitched cross-gable roof.
[3] It was added to the National Register of Historic Places on July 5, 2001.
